Secluded River Front Luxury On The Kenai River

Spacious 3 Bedroom / 3 Bathroom 2,300 square foot river front home on the Kenai River, located in the community of Funny River in Soldotna, Alaska. Modern two story home with large, screened wrap around attached deck, separate ground level deck outside with fire pit, outdoor kitchen w/ sink, gas and charcoal barbeques, 80 plus feet of river front fishing platforms, covered fish cleaning station and a huge parking area. Enormous kitchen with gas range, corian countertops, two refrigerators and dishwasher. Two master bedrooms on top floor, each with a King Size Bed, their own full master bathroom and HDTV. Two smaller bunkrooms on top floor, each with bunk beds. Queen bedroom on bottom floor, with shared full bathroom. Living room features gas fireplace and HDTV. Satellite TV and internet, Washer, Dryer, Smoker, food saver and full size freezer to store your fishing bounty.

About the host

Hosted by Jason Nichols

Host profile image
A second generation Alaskan, I was born in Anchorage and raised on the Kenai River - learning to fish before riding a bike. I make my home in Anchorage with my wife and two kids. Our friend and co-owner also lives in Anchorage with his wife and two children. We purchased this property from our in laws when my father in law retired - when he isn't snow birding in Arizona, he serves as the property's resident handy man and story teller.

When we aren't in the "big city", we are enjoying the amazing fishing and peaceful tranquility this property has to offer. We hope you enjoy your stay at this piece of heaven on the river.

Why they chose this property

The family purchased this property in the summer of 2005, when it was just a shell on the foundation. Everything from the ground up has been meticulously added and installed, using only quality materials, fixtures and appliances. Over the years we have added things to make it 'just right' - from the covered fire pit with Trex decking to the covered fish cleaning station situated next to riverside fishing platforms. As our family has expanded, so has entertainment for the kids in the form of a sandbox, swing set and zip line.
